万科单季再亏160.7亿负债率73.51% 深铁年内已输血269.3亿助力纾困
Chang Jiang Shang Bao· 2025-11-02 23:16
Core Viewpoint - Vanke reported a significant increase in losses for Q3, with a net profit loss of 160.69 billion yuan, a 98.61% decline year-on-year, attributed to reduced revenue from development business and low gross margins [1][5]. Financial Performance - Q3 revenue was 560.7 billion yuan, down 27.3% year-on-year [1][5]. - For the first three quarters, total revenue was 1613.88 billion yuan, a decrease of 26.61% year-on-year [5]. - The net profit loss for the first three quarters reached 280.16 billion yuan, a 56.14% decline year-on-year [5]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was approximately -58.89 billion yuan, down 21.49% year-on-year [5]. - Contract sales area for the first three quarters was 775.1 million square meters, with a contract sales amount of 1004.6 billion yuan, representing declines of 41.8% and 44.6% respectively [5]. Debt and Liquidity - The company’s debt-to-asset ratio stood at 73.51%, higher than the industry average of 60.51% [4][7]. - Vanke has repaid 288.9 billion yuan of public debt as of the Q3 report date [4][7]. - The company has received a total of 269.3 billion yuan in loans from its major shareholder, Shenzhen Metro Group, excluding the latest loan [2][3][8]. Strategic Measures - Vanke is actively engaging in asset management and liquidity improvement strategies, including large-scale asset transactions and exploring new asset activation paths [9]. - The company is focusing on a closed-loop model for its business operations, enhancing cooperation with institutional investors and government policies [9]. - Vanke has made organizational adjustments to strengthen its headquarters and streamline regional management [10]. Market Performance - Despite overall performance challenges, some projects have shown strong sales, such as the Guangzhou Ideal Huadi project, which ranked first in sales in the main urban area [6]. - During the National Day holiday, Vanke achieved a subscription amount of 47.7 billion yuan, exceeding its target by 137% [6].
微软开启全球新一轮裁员:涉9000个岗位,游戏业务受冲击
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-07-03 05:25
Group 1 - Microsoft announced a global workforce reduction affecting approximately 9,000 employees, which is less than 4% of its total workforce, impacting multiple teams, regions, and levels of staff [1] - The gaming division is undergoing significant changes, with hundreds of employees laid off from various studios, including those behind popular franchises like Call of Duty and Halo [1] - Microsoft has canceled several long-developed game projects, including Everwild and an original online game from ZeniMax Online Studios, as well as the reboot of Perfect Dark [1] Group 2 - Phil Spencer, CEO of Microsoft's gaming division, stated that the company is making strategic choices to focus on growth areas and improve agility and efficiency by reducing management layers [2] - Spencer mentioned that affected employees will receive priority consideration for other open positions within the company, emphasizing the strength of Microsoft's platform, hardware, and game development roadmap [2] - Microsoft has conducted multiple rounds of layoffs this year, totaling approximately 18,000 employees, including a previous reduction of over 6,000 in May and around 2,300 in June [2] Group 3 - The layoffs in the gaming division were anticipated due to pressure to improve profit margins following Microsoft's $69 billion acquisition of Activision Blizzard in October 2023 [3] - This marks the fourth major round of layoffs in the Xbox division over the past 18 months, with a focus on the marketing department [3] - As of July 2, Microsoft's stock price slightly decreased by 0.2% to $491.09 per share, with a total market capitalization of $3.65 trillion [3]
荣耀李健上任140天:动了38个核心岗位,目标重返国内前三
第一财经· 2025-05-29 14:33
Core Viewpoint - Honor is undergoing significant organizational changes and needs a strong performance to regain market confidence after facing declining market share and increased competition from other smartphone brands [2][3]. Group 1: Organizational Changes - Honor's new CEO, Li Jian, has implemented major adjustments to the organizational structure, affecting 38 key positions in the China region, with 45% of the position heads changed [4]. - The new management team includes CMO Guo Rui, Product Line President Fang Fei, CEO Li Jian, CFO Peng Qiuwen, and Sales and Service President Wang Ban [2]. - Li Jian emphasized that all business issues are ultimately organizational issues, and the focus is on revitalizing the team's combat effectiveness [3][4]. Group 2: Market Performance - According to Canalys, Honor's market share in China's smartphone market was 15% in 2024, ranking fifth, which is a decline of 1 percentage point from 2023, with a year-on-year growth rate of -3% [2]. - In Q1 2024, Honor's market share was 13.7%, ranking sixth, with the top five being Huawei, Vivo, Xiaomi, OPPO, and Apple [3]. - Honor's sales have been under pressure, with only two new products launched in the first half of the year, making it challenging to maintain market share [3]. Group 3: Future Goals and Strategies - Honor aims to return to the top three in the domestic market by the end of the year, focusing on improving basic skills without setting performance assessments for the China region [4]. - The company has seen significant growth in overseas markets, with a 283% increase in shipments in Africa, entering the top five for the first time [4]. - CFO Peng Qiuwen mentioned that the company has completed its share reform and is preparing for an IPO, with various intermediary institutions engaged in the process [5].
